City of Bridgeport - Public Library

Circulation Services Librarian

Posted on October 05, 2021

Application submission deadline: October 11, 2021 at 3:30 PM EST

Job Status: Full-Time

Reports to: Library Director

Job Summary & Qualifications:

Job Summary:

The City of Bridgeport Public Library is in search of a full-time Circulation Services Librarian. This position reports directly to the Library Director and performs a variety of supervisory, training, and patron-centric duties in a public library. Much of the work is patron-based in nature and involves the application of standard library procedures and routines. Duties include but are not limited to training, scheduling, and supervising Library Aides; maintaining documentation on all assigned staff members and any problems that might arise at the circulation desk; keeping extensive circulation statistics; tracking usage of electronic resources; communicating patron issues and requests to the Library Director; providing excellent customer service to patrons by ensuring all part-time staff members follow current policies and procedures; maintaining supervisory notes and preparing interim and annual evaluations; creating daily assignments for part-time staff; communicating with building vendors; coordinating interlibrary loan requests; and handling biweekly transits within library consortium. This is a full-time position and requires working days, evenings, and weekends as scheduled.

Required Qualifications:

· Bachelor’s Degree required, preferably with two or more years of library experience, or any equivalent combination of experience and training which provides the required knowledge, skills, and abilities.

· Good written and verbal communication skills and ability to effectively interact with the public and coworkers in a courteous and tactful manner.

· Familiarity with Microsoft Office Applications.
